Kings vs Nets 2026: Malik Monk's Clutch Performance Secures 126-122 Win! | NBA Highlights (2026)

In a thrilling NBA showdown, the Sacramento Kings secured a much-needed victory against the struggling Brooklyn Nets, 126-122. This game was a testament to the power of individual performances and clutch moments that can define a team's fate.

Malik Monk's Masterclass

The hero of the night was undoubtedly Malik Monk, who showcased his scoring prowess with 32 points. What makes Monk's performance truly remarkable is his ability to step up when it matters most. He scored 10 points in the final five minutes, including two crucial free throws, demonstrating a level of composure that is the hallmark of elite players. Rookie Sensation and Veteran Presence

This game also highlighted the Kings' promising future with rookie Maxime Raynaud's 16th double-double of the season. Raynaud's consistency is a rare find in a rookie, and his performance alongside veteran DeMar DeRozan, who added 10 points and 8 assists, showcases the Kings' potential for a dynamic inside-out game. Nets' Struggles Continue

On the other side of the court, the Nets' woes persist, as they suffer their seventh consecutive loss. Despite solid performances from Ben Saraf and Ziaire Williams, the Nets couldn't overcome the Kings' momentum. Coaching Connections

An interesting side note to this game was the presence of Arkansas coach John Calipari, who mentored Monk during his college days at Kentucky.
